Academics is seeking an Autism Support Worker for a full-time position in Slough. The role involves supporting children with diverse needs in a classroom setting, assisting with their daily tasks, and maintaining an engaging learning environment.

Candidates should ideally have experience with SEN children, be patient and nurturing, and have excellent communication skills. This role offers valuable experience for those aspiring to work in psychology or education.
